Carissa Moore’s Childhood
The future champion was born on a summer day in 1992. Growing up in Hawaii, she had an environment perfect for learning surfing.
Her father, Chris Moore, introduced her to surfing at an early stage of childhood. Together they spent many mornings at the beach. These early experiences helped develop her technique.
By the time she was competing in junior competitions, the talented young athlete had already earned recognition in the surfing community.

Carissa Moore at the Olympics
One of the most important moments in Carissa Moore’s career came when surfing was introduced in the Olympic Games.
During the 2020 Tokyo Olympics, the professional surfing champion represented Team USA.
Her performance was incredible. After a series of impressive rides, she won the top Olympic prize.
This achievement solidified her position as a legendary athlete.
